Job Description

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Performs radiographic procedures as requested by physicians and Radiologist.
  • Has a good understanding of advance anatomy.
  • Provides excellent care for patients and an understanding that they may be in pain; follows AIDET guidelines.
  • Makes sure to check positive identification before performing all exams.
  • Has advanced knowledge of contrast media, how it affects patients and what action to take in the event of a reaction.
  • Checks and double checks all contrast before it is given to the patient and charts contrast usage appropriately in the patients chart.
  • Able to obtain diagnostic quality images for interpretation by a Radiologist.
  • Has the ability to manipulate the x-ray machine to acquire adequate images even when the patients are not able to move.
  • Understand that the operating room is a priority and that the surgeons needs need to be attended to quickly.

Education and Experience:

  • High school diploma or equivalent and graduation from accredited Radiologic Technology Program required.
  • Minimum one year experience required which can be substituted with clinical education experience.

Certifications/ License:

  • ARRT and New Mexico State licenses required.
  • BLS certification issued through American Heart Association required.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:

  • Thorough knowledge of radiographic imaging equipment, anatomy and physiology, radiographic positioning, medical terminology and basic computer skills.

Physical Requirements:

  • Prolonged, extensive or considerate standing and walking.
  • Lifts, positions, pushes and or transfers patients and equipment in excess of 50 lbs.
  • Exposure to various body fluids and ionizing radiation.
